Recognizing the Sources Of Basement Dampness
Although cellars are often designed to be useful and completely dry rooms, they can fall sufferer to dampness because of different variables. One main reason is bad drain around the structure, which can result in water pooling and infiltration. In addition, heavy rains or quick snowmelt can overwhelm drain systems, worsening wetness problems. Another significant aspect is the natural humidity present in the ground, which can permeate with floors and wall surfaces, especially in older homes with less effective obstacles. Fractures in the structure may additionally allow water breach, specifically throughout periods of heavy precipitation. Plumbing leakages within the basement can contribute to moisture accumulation, developing a setting helpful to mold growth. Finally, inadequate ventilation can trap humidity, intensifying the overall dampness problem. Understanding these reasons is crucial for house owners seeking effective remedies to prevent basement dampness problems.
Kinds of Basement Waterproofing Methods
Cellar waterproofing approaches are essential for shielding homes from wetness damages and maintaining a safe living atmosphere. These techniques can be generally classified right into exterior and indoor remedies. Inside waterproofing typically entails the installation of drain systems, sump pumps, and vapor obstacles. These systems function to divert water away from the cellar and protect against dampness from permeating via the walls or floor.On the other hand, outside waterproofing focuses on stopping water from entering the home in the top place. This can include excavation around the foundation, applying water resistant layers, and mounting drainage tiles to redirect water far from the framework. Furthermore, some property owners may go with a mix of both interior and outside techniques to assure thorough defense. Inevitably, the selection of waterproofing technique relies on the particular conditions of the home and the degree of moisture existing in the basement.
Products Used in Waterproofing Solutions

Various products are employed in waterproofing solutions to improve the effectiveness of both outside and indoor approaches. Commonly utilized materials include liquid membranes, which develop a seamless barrier versus dampness. These membranes are generally made from polyurethane or rubberized asphalt, providing versatility and durability. Furthermore, cementitious waterproofing products are prominent for their convenience of application and strong attachment to surfaces.For exterior applications, materials such as drain boards and geotextiles work in redirecting water away from structures. Upkeep and Prevention Tips for a Dry Cellar
Routine maintenance and aggressive steps are essential to making sure a completely dry basement long after first waterproofing initiatives. Homeowners need to consistently inspect downspouts and seamless gutters, guaranteeing they direct water far from the structure. It is necessary to keep these clear of debris to stop overflow. Additionally, maintaining appropriate rating around the home helps network water far from the structure.Checking for cracks in wall surfaces or floors is crucial, as these can permit dampness seepage. Any kind of recognized splits need to be promptly sealed with ideal materials. Mounting a sump pump can provide added defense against flooding.Humidity degrees in the cellar should also be kept track of, as high moisture can lead to mold development. Making use of a dehumidifier can aid keep a comfy environment. Making sure correct air flow in the basement help in minimizing dampness accumulation, preserving the integrity of the waterproofing system over time.

What Are the Signs of Inadequate Waterproofing?
Indications of why not try here insufficient waterproofing include relentless dampness, mold and mildew growth, mildewy odors, peeling paint, and water stains on walls or floors. Home owners should deal with these concerns without delay to stop further damages and maintain a healthy living environment.
